So I think it is worth knowing the lldb actually uses
PTRACE_O_TRACEEXIT.  So we can test at least some programs to verify
that all is well.

I don't see any way around cleaning up PTRACE_O_TRACEEXIT.  As
we fundamentally have the non-thread-group-leader exec problem.
We have to reap that previous leader thread with release_task.
Which means we can't stop for a PTRACE_O_TRACEEXIT.

Oh, this is another story, needs another discussion. We really need some
changes in this area, we need to distinguish SIGKILL sent from user-space
and (say) from group-exit, and we need to decide when should we stop.

But at least I think the tracee should never stop if SIGKILL comes from
user space. And yes ptrace_stop() is ugly and wrong, just look at the
arch_ptrace_stop_needed() check. The problem, again, is that any fix will
be user-visible.
The only issue I see is that arch_ptrace_stop() may sleep (sparc and
ia64 do as they flush the register stack to memory).  As the
code may sleep it means we can't set TASK_TRACED until after calling
arch_ptrace_stop().

My inclination is to just solve that by saying:
if (!sigkill_pending(current))
	set_current_task(TASK_TRACED);

That removes the special case.  We have to handle SIGKILL being
delivered immediately after set_current_state in any event.  And as we
are talking about something that happens on rare architecutres I don't
see any problem with tweaking that code at all.

It is closely enough related I will fold that into the next version of
my patch.
